The Hakodatekan Post Office building that was constructed in 1911 was remodeled into a shopping mall, currently referred to as the Hakodate Meijikan. Located in the bay area bustling with tourists, a rich variety of souvenir shops have collected here, offering an abundance of products, including glassware, Hakodate wine, marine products, and other general goods. There are also workshops in which participants can make original crafts such as music boxes and glassware as well Japanese-style clothes and dress rental. (Workshops must be reserved in advance on the official website.)
